Course Description:
Strategies for integrating technology into the teaching and learning process, with a focus on enhancing how students think rather than what they think. Special attention given to supporting higher order thinking and problem solving with technology.
Reflection:
I thought I was comfortable and knowledgeable about technology tools for the classroom, but this course really expanded my knowledge base! Right away, we were to do an introduction using Voice Thread, which until then I had never heard of. Immediately I started thinking of all the ways I could use this with my own students. This is just one example of the probably hundreds of new tools I was exposed to in this course. Of all the new tools I was introduced to, my favorite was probably Newsy. I have already planned lessons this year that incorporate Newsy and my students love it.
Not only did the course teach me about new technologies, but I also got to dig deeper on some that I was aware of but had never had the time to explore and really get familiar with. For me, this was a coding website called Tynker that I created a Voice Thread presentation for. In creating the presentation, I really had to become an expert on the site and learned a lot of things that I didn't previously know about it.
Technology in the classroom is not easy, and can be very intimidating and overwhelming at times. However, we need to prepare our students for a technological world, so we need to embrace and run with it! The tools and ideas I discovered in this course will definitely help me do that.
